| | Association of Midwest Museums |
 | | The Association of Midwest Museums (AMM), founded in 1927, is a dynamic, non-profit membership organization that provides resources to museums and cultural institutions and services to museum professionals in an eight-state region in the Midwest, including Illinois, Indiana, Iowa, Michigan, Minnesota, Missouri, Ohio, and Wisconsin. |
 | | AMM provides a forum for dialogue and an exchange of ideas, helps create and sustain strong cultural institutions, and fosters professional development and leadership within the museum community. |
 | | Through it's programs and activities, AMM encourages professional standards for all areas of museum administration and provides cutting-edge information and resources to museums and cultural institutions in the Midwest and the greater museum community. |
